Description
Summary: The Sr. Process Development Engineer will provide technical leadership in the innovation, design, development and optimization of new and modified manufacturing processes, tooling and equipment for innovative single use medical devices for therapeutic applications. A core focus of this role is leading the design transfer process — working with a cross functional team during early-phase design to ensure manufacturability, authoring and executing process validation protocols (IQ/OQ/PQ), and providing input on SOPs, work instructions, and Medical Device File documentation required to support successful product design transfers to manufacturing. The position offers the unique opportunity to partake in a growth-stage start-up company with career advancement opportunities. The right individual has process development and design transfer experience from collaboration with quality and operations, brings deep knowledge of process validation requirements under QMSR and ISO 13485, and is eager to face engineering challenges and participate in ongoing process improvements.
Essential Duties and Responsibilities:
Lead design transfer activities from R&D to manufacturing, including development and execution of Installation Qualification (IQ), Operational Qualification (OQ), and Performance Qualification (PQ) protocols in compliance with FDA QMSR and ISO 13485 requirements
Perform process optimization through design of experiments and process capability studies
Engage early in the product design cycle as a manufacturing and process subject matter expert, providing design for manufacturability (DFM) input to development team to reduce downstream transfer risk and accelerate time to production readiness
Establish standard work and standard equipment operating parameters
Author, review, and maintain documentation in support of design transfer and process validation; ensure documentation meets Medical Device File requirements
Demonstrates team leadership with a hands-on approach
Develop and implement automation solutions
Troubleshoot equipment problems and develop corrective actions
Analyze quality problems and develop solutions and improvements
Ensure adequate engineering studies, design verification, and process validation are completed such that well-characterized, transfer-ready processes are introduced into manufacturing; maintain traceability between process validation outcomes and design inputs
Work with Quality Control to resolve supplier quality issues
Manage the end-to-end design transfer process, coordinating cross-functionally with R&D, Quality, Regulatory, and Operations to ensure complete and compliant product transfers; define and track transfer readiness criteria and milestone deliverables
May supervise and guide the daily activities of technicians and junior engineers.
Responsible for achieving device manufacturing and engineering operational objectives in support of product performance, process validation, quality, cost and safety
Enforce compliance to all Good Manufacturing Practices and Standard Operating Procedures as defined by the Company’s policies, practices and procedures
Skills and Qualifications:
BS in Manufacturing, Mechanical, Industrial or Plastics Engineering
7+ years experience in an equipment intensive medical device manufacturing environment
1-2 years of direct supervisory experience is a plus
Project management experience is preferred
Proficient with SolidWorks, with a demonstrated ability to design, prototype, and evaluate fixtures and tooling is a plus
Experience with plastics processing (extrusion, injection molding, fiber forming) is preferred
Solid understanding of ISO 13485, FDA QMSR, and design transfer requirements; direct experience writing and executing process validation protocols (IQ/OQ/PQ) is required
Demonstrated ability to stay organized and implement organizational skills into their team members
Strong verbal and written communication skills is essential
Ability to respond to changing priorities and to multi-task, in a dynamic environment

Access Vascular was founded in 2015 to address the most common and costly complications of intravenous therapy: infection, thrombosis and phlebitis. The company is developing a suite of venous access devices made from patented biomaterials which are highly biocompatible and have demonstrated 6X fewer complications. .
